The arms are canting. Radkersburg appears to be called after a medieval nobleman, but this is disputed among historians. For centuries, the city has used a seal showing a wheel (Rad). | The arms are canting. Radkersburg appears to be called after a medieval nobleman, but this is disputed among historians.
